Lakota West’s Krugler to swim at Toledo
Lakota West High senior Maegen Krugler will swim collegiately at the University of Toledo.
At last season’s state meet, Krugler finished 11th in the 100-yard freestyle and 12th in the 200 free.
“She is a good middle-distance freestyler and has the potential to improve during her freshman year and help us out,” Toledo coach Lars Jorgensen said in a statement.

Fulcher interested in Mason job
Former Cincinnati Bengal standout David Fulcher is interested in the head coaching vacancy at Mason High School.
That’s what Fulcher told host Mark Schlemmer on Dayton radio station WONE-AM (980) on Friday evening.
Dave Sedmak resigned last week after three seasons at Mason.
Fulcher’s son, David Jr., is a 5-foot-10, 185-pound junior running back at Mason. He was injured in the Comets’ first game of the season vs. Trotwood-Madison and missed the rest of the season.
Fulcher played eight seasons in the NFL, including seven with the Bengals. He was a three-time pro bowl safety for Cincinnati.

Recap of Lakota West’s Hicks conference call
Lakota West senior OLB Jordan Hicks held his weekly media conference call this morning, Nov. 16, and here are the highlights.
—Hicks will sit down with his mother, Kelly Justice, some time this week to figure out if he will officially visit Alabama and USC.
—Hicks spoke about how basketball practice is going under new coach Sean Van Winkle.
“It’s a lot different,” Hicks said. “He just brings a lot of energy in everything we do. It’s run to the center court when he calls a huddle up. Just hustling everywhere you go. There’s really no breaks. You’re doing something the whole time. It’s just really productive.”
—West coach Larry Cox said senior TE Alex Smith — who committed to Cincinnati in February — will announce his official decision tomorrow. Smith’s short list has UC, North Carolina and Wisconsin on it. Smith was at the UC game Friday night, then went to North Carolina over the weekend.
—Cox also said junior center Ryan Kelly (6-5, 260) has been invited to participate in the Under Armour combine the week of the Under Armour game in January.
